Briarcliff Students Prepare For Annual Dance Concert

'Stand in the Light and Be Seen as We Are' is the theme for the annual dance concert that will feature a variety of dance styles on Apr.1&2.

From Briarcliff Manor School District: Briarcliff middle and high school dancers are preparing for the annual dance concert, “Stand in the Light and Be Seen as We Are,” which will be presented on April 1 and 2.

The concert will feature a variety of dance types, including Bollywood dancing and student-created pieces developed in an improvisational class.

“Students were given titles to three paintings and were asked to come up with something,” said dance teacher Diane Guida of the latter pieces.
